C&DMA Powers & Functions
Overview
The Commissioner & Director of Municipal Administration is the Head of the Department and exercises supervision and control over the functioning of all Urban Local Bodies except Municipal Corporations in the State.
Powers
- Exercise supervision and control over the functioning of all Urban Local Bodies except Municipal Corporations
- Inspect or cause to inspect the offices of the Municipalities
- Call for any record, document, register or correspondence from the Municipalities
- Issue necessary instructions to the Municipalities
- Recommend to Government for suspension of resolutions of Municipal Council
- Recommend to Government for cancellation of illegal orders issued by the Municipalities
Key Functions
- Supervision and control over the functioning of Municipalities
- Implementation of various schemes sanctioned by the Government
- Monitoring the collection of taxes and non-taxes in Municipalities
- Monitoring the implementation of developmental works in Municipalities
- Conducting enquiries on allegations against Municipal functionaries
- Providing technical guidance to the Municipalities
- Arranging capacity building programs to the Municipal functionaries
- Processing proposals for upgradation of Municipalities
- Processing proposals for inclusion and exclusion of areas in Municipalities
- Monitoring the maintenance of parks, playgrounds and burial grounds
- Monitoring the implementation of social security pensions
- Implementation of e-governance in Municipalities
Administrative Functions
- Transfers and postings of Municipal Commissioners Grade-III and IV
- Transfers and postings of Municipal Engineers
- Transfers and postings of Town Planning Officers
- Disciplinary control over Municipal Staff
- Processing of appeals filed by Municipal employees
- Processing pension cases of Municipal employees
